Dragging and Dropping in Actionscript 3.0

Ok this is a little tip for Dragging your clips on Actionscript 3.0, remember how we used a lot of tricks in Flash to drag a clip from other points that weren’t the anchor point , well in Actionscript 3.0 (herenow AS3) is quite simple to do that by using the new Point class.
Class Point.
Package flash.geom
Class public class Point
InheritancePoint Object
Language version: ActionScript 3.0
Player version: Flash Player 9
The Point object represents a location in a two-dimensional coordinate system, where x represents the horizontal axis and y represents the vertical axis.

So here’s a very short example made in AS3 in wish no matter where your grab the Sprite, it will be dragged from that specific Point.
Heres the example :

This movie requires Flash Player 10

Open in New Window

Here’s the code:

bear.addEventListener(MouseEvent.MOUSE_DOWN, startbearDrag);
stage.addEventListener(MouseEvent.MOUSE_UP, stopbearDrag);
bear.addEventListener(Event.ENTER_FRAME, dragbear);
var clickOffset:Point = null;
function startbearDrag(event:MouseEvent) {
	clickOffset = new Point(event.localX, event.localY);
function stopbearDrag(event:MouseEvent) {
	clickOffset = null;
function dragbear(event:Event) {
	if (clickOffset != null) {
		bear.x = mouseX - clickOffset.x;
		bear.y = mouseY - clickOffset.y;

SHARE beta On Adobe Labs

SHARE beta Adobe

SHARE Detail

Hi everyone I just discovered this great app on the Adobe Labs although it’s up since 1 of October I didn’t pay much attention to it. Share it’s a wonderful app that lets You upload share and preview documents online, what do You need to use it simple, an Adobe id and documents to share, it works this way You log in to share and upload your files then you select with who you want to share it by adding e-mail adresses (nothing it’s attached to the receiver only a link to your shared files) then you can select whereas the file its for public viewing ( to everyone that knows the adress of the file ) or if it’s private (only viewable to the persons you added on the list). You can access it from any computer and embed the content in webpages.
And it’s all on Flash Player you don’t need anything but the Flash Player 9 to view it and use it.
So check it out, it’s a beta but it’s seems very promising.


Here’s what Adobe says about it:
Welcome to a preview of Adobe’s latest online offering codenamed “Share”, a free web-based service that allows you to easily share, publish and organize your documents.

With Share you can:

* Send documents without email attachments.
* Access your documents from anywhere.
* View all the documents you have shared or received in one place.
* Post a link to your document on a wiki or blog.
* Embed a Flash preview of your document on any website.
* Limit access to a document to a list of recipients.

And here’s the link: Adobe SHARE beta.

Adobe Labs Updates AIR( beta 2 ), Flex 3 ( beta 2 ) and prereleases AMP (Adobe Media Player )

Well good month start in Adobe labs, they have released an update for Adobe Air ( beta 2 ) Flex 3 ( beta 2 ) and a Prerelease of Adobe AMP (Adobe Media Player ).

Adobe AIR public beta 2

Adobe Air Beta3

Update: A new version of the Adobe AIR download was posted on 10/1/2007.

Adobe AIR is a cross-operating system runtime that allows web application developers to use their existing web development skills (HTML, Javascript, Adobe Flash, Adobe Flex, Ajax ) to build and deploy rich Internet applications to the desktop.

Download the AIR beta 2 update here

Flex 3 public beta 2

Flex 3 beta 2

This near feature complete release adds powerful new data wizard support for .NET, web service introspection and connection code generation, and much more. We’ve also added support for importing and exporting Flex projects so that you can now share projects easily. Complete support is also now available for CSS.

Download The Flex 3 beta 2 here

The Adobe Media Player Prerelease

AMP prerelease

The Adobe Media Player enables end users to enjoy their shows whenever and wherever they want, while enabling new ways for content businesses to create, deliver, and monetize high-quality content and advertising through a customizable cross-platform player that supports both downloaded and streamed media.

Download AMP Prerelease here

Flash Lite 3 Update for Flash CS3 Professional

A great update for Flash Lite Developers
Flash Lite 3

Author, test, and publish mobile content for the latest release of Flash Lite software, which can support video (FLV) and rendering of SWF files for Flash Player 8 when integrated within a mobile phone or embedded web browser. Authoring support for Flash Lite requires both an update to Device Central CS3 as well as an update to Flash CS3 Professional software.

Download the update for Flash CS3 here
Download the update for Device Central CS3 here